KPMG has appointed Tudor Aw, a London-based partner who also leads KPMG's digital services, to head the technology division of its UK information, communication and entertainment practice.
Aw, who joined KPMG in 1986 straight from university in Australia, has just completed a four-year secondment in the US where he was based in Washington DC and New York. He has extensive experience of global projects across the US, UK, Germany, Antigua, Australia, France, Hong Kong and India, according to Consultant-News.com.
He has more than 20 years of audit and consulting experience, working in the converging technology, communications and media sectors. Aw’s main role has been to assist clients manage risk, evaluate strategic opportunities and achieve operational improvements.
‘These continue to be exciting times for the fast moving technology sector with innovations continuing apace and new business models developing around digital convergence,' Aw said.
